Does this happen exclusively with the audio samples he's importing, or is he having problems playing back anything? His problem may be more specific than the problem I had with silence-where-there-should-be-sound in Sonar 3, but this may or may not help you:

Do you get signal showing in the level meters during playback?

- If so, Sonar's output is not making it to the sound card ... make sure the sound card's drivers are properly selected in the Sonar audio options, and that your tracks and master fader are routed correctly to the card's outputs.

- If not, you may have a mis-match in the sample rate of your project versus the sample rate of your sound card. It's kinda weird, you can open your project and mess around with it with a sample rate mismatch but no signal will be routed through the program, and definately not to your speakers.
